Train to the plane 

Recently, KONE also won an order to provide 33 high-end elevators for the Delhi Airport Metro Express Line. Part of the greater Delhi metro project, this new metro line is being constructed to provide direct connectivity from the existing metro stations to the Delhi International Airport.

The 22.7 kilometer (14.1 mile) high-speed link, which is slated to run at about 135 kilometers (84 miles) per hour, will take passengers from the New Delhi Railway station directly to the international airport in just 18 minutes. The project is estimated for completion before the Commonwealth Games in July 2010.
